| | def unpack_archive( |
| | filename, extract_dir, progress_filter=default_filter, drivers=None |
| | ) -> None: |
| | """Unpack `filename` to `extract_dir`, or raise ``UnrecognizedFormat`` |
| | |
| | `progress_filter` is a function taking two arguments: a source path |
| | internal to the archive ('/'-separated), and a filesystem path where it |
| | will be extracted. The callback must return the desired extract path |
| | (which may be the same as the one passed in), or else ``None`` to skip |
| | that file or directory. The callback can thus be used to report on the |
| | progress of the extraction, as well as to filter the items extracted or |
| | alter their extraction paths. |
| | |
| | `drivers`, if supplied, must be a non-empty sequence of functions with the |
| | same signature as this function (minus the `drivers` argument), that raise |
| | ``UnrecognizedFormat`` if they do not support extracting the designated |
| | archive type. The `drivers` are tried in sequence until one is found that |
| | does not raise an error, or until all are exhausted (in which case |
| | ``UnrecognizedFormat`` is raised). If you do not supply a sequence of |
| | drivers, the module's ``extraction_drivers`` constant will be used, which |
| | means that ``unpack_zipfile`` and ``unpack_tarfile`` will be tried, in that |
| | order. |
| | """ |
| | for driver in drivers or extraction_drivers: |
| | try: |
| | driver(filename, extract_dir, progress_filter) |
| | except UnrecognizedFormat: |
| | continue |
| | else: |
| | return |
| | else: |
| | raise UnrecognizedFormat(f"Not a recognized archive type: {filename}") |

| | def unpack_zipfile(filename, extract_dir, progress_filter=default_filter) -> None: |
| | """Unpack zip `filename` to `extract_dir` |
| | |
| | Raises ``UnrecognizedFormat`` if `filename` is not a zipfile (as determined |
| | by ``zipfile.is_zipfile()``). See ``unpack_archive()`` for an explanation |
| | of the `progress_filter` argument. |
| | """ |
| |
|
| | if not zipfile.is_zipfile(filename): |
| | raise UnrecognizedFormat(f"{filename} is not a zip file") |
| |
|
| | with zipfile.ZipFile(filename) as z: |
| | _unpack_zipfile_obj(z, extract_dir, progress_filter) |
| |
|
| |
|
| | def _unpack_zipfile_obj(zipfile_obj, extract_dir, progress_filter=default_filter): |
| | """Internal/private API used by other parts of setuptools. |
| | Similar to ``unpack_zipfile``, but receives an already opened :obj:`zipfile.ZipFile` |
| | object instead of a filename. |
| | """ |
| | for info in zipfile_obj.infolist(): |
| | name = info.filename |
| |
|
| | |
| | if name.startswith('/') or '..' in name.split('/'): |
| | continue |
| |
|
| | target = os.path.join(extract_dir, *name.split('/')) |
| | target = progress_filter(name, target) |
| | if not target: |
| | continue |
| | if name.endswith('/'): |
| | |
| | ensure_directory(target) |
| | else: |
| | |
| | ensure_directory(target) |
| | data = zipfile_obj.read(info.filename) |
| | with open(target, 'wb') as f: |
| | f.write(data) |
| | unix_attributes = info.external_attr >> 16 |
| | if unix_attributes: |
| | os.chmod(target, unix_attributes) |
